Peach Pretzel Jello Salad

Hereโ€™s a sweet, salty, and totally nostalgic recipe for a Peach Pretzel Jello Salad โ€” a refreshing layered dessert thatโ€™s perfect for potlucks, summer barbecues, or family gatherings. Itโ€™s a fun twist on the classic Strawberry Pretzel Salad!


๐Ÿ‘ Peach Pretzel Jello Salad

Prep Time: 30 minutes (plus chilling time)
Chill Time: 4+ hours (or overnight)
Serves: 12


๐Ÿ“ Ingredients:

๐Ÿ”ธ Pretzel Crust:

  • 2 cups crushed pretzels (about 5โ€“6 cups whole pretzels)
  • ยพ cup unsalted butter, melted
  • 3 tbsp granulated sugar

๐Ÿ”ธ Cream Cheese Layer:

  • 8 oz cream cheese, softened
  • ยพ cup granulated sugar
  • 1 (8 oz) tub whipped topping (like Cool Whip)

๐Ÿ”ธ Jello & Peach Layer:

  • 1 (6 oz) box peach Jello
  • 2 cups boiling water
  • 1 cup cold water
  • 2โ€“3 cups sliced canned peaches (drained) or fresh ripe peaches

๐Ÿ‘ฉโ€๐Ÿณ Instructions:

๐Ÿ”ธ 1. Make the Pretzel Crust:

  1. Preheat oven to 350ยฐF (175ยฐC).
  2. Combine crushed pretzels, melted butter, and sugar. Mix well.
  3. Press into the bottom of a 9×13-inch baking dish.
  4. Bake for 10 minutes, then cool completely.

๐Ÿ”ธ 2. Cream Cheese Layer:

  1. Beat cream cheese and sugar together until smooth.
  2. Fold in whipped topping until fluffy and combined.
  3. Spread evenly over the cooled pretzel crust.
    ๐Ÿ‘‰ Important: Spread all the way to the edges to “seal” the crust and prevent Jello from leaking through.
  4. Chill in the fridge while you make the Jello.

๐Ÿ”ธ 3. Jello-Peach Layer:

  1. Dissolve peach Jello in 2 cups boiling water. Stir until completely dissolved.
  2. Add 1 cup cold water and let cool slightly (but not set).
  3. Stir in sliced peaches.
  4. Carefully pour Jello mixture over the cream cheese layer.
  5. Refrigerate for at least 4 hours or until fully set.

๐Ÿฝ To Serve:

  • Cut into squares and serve chilled.
  • Garnish with whipped cream or a fresh peach slice if desired.

โœ… Tips:

  • Use fresh peaches when in season for the best flavor.
  • Want a twist? Mix in a few raspberries or blueberries with the peaches.
  • Make ahead the night before for easier slicing and full setting.
